Man Caught Driving To Ex-Wife’s Grave To Pee On It Every Day By Woman’s Horrified Children

A New Jersey family was horrified to discover that their beloved mother’s ex-husband had been regularly urinating on her grave. Michael Murphy, 43, was fed up with his mother, Linda Louise Torello, having her final resting place desecrated, so he set up a hidden camera to find the culprit. What they discovered was worse than they could have imagined.

  1. The family was regularly finding bags of poo on the grave. They’d been left atop her headstone, leading Murphy and his family to place the camera there to catch the suspect in the act. When they watched the footage back, they were absolutely horrified to discover their mom’s ex-husband rolling up five days a week to pee there.
  2. The ex-husband even brought his current partner along with him one of the times. Given that the man and Murphy’s mother divorced more than 48 years ago, it’s unclear what the man’s motivation could be for doing such a terrible thing. However,the Daily Mail reports that he once told his daughter, Murphy’s half-sister, that he wished he never had her. Sounds like a lovely guy!
  3. Murphy shared the findings on his Facebook page, where friends and extended family members expressed their shock. “THIS IS BREAKING MY HEART. A man from Bergen county New Jersey has been leaving bags of poo and pissing on my mother’s tombstone almost every morning like a normal routine’ assisted by his wife also,” he wrote. “We have weeks and months of evidence. It has been reported to the police and the news outlets. No one in my family has had contact with him since 1976 or so how he found my mother’s grave site we are not sure. But this stems back to a problem almost 50 years ago. Pray for us thank you and please share this!!!”
  4. Sadly, the man is not facing any criminal charges. Despite being reported to police, it seems as though no investigation is underway and authorities won’t be pursuing charges against the man. However, the police did give the family permission to keep the camera near the gravesite.
  5. Since the footage was made public, the man has stopped coming by to pee on the woman’s grave. “I believe he stopped but I’m so protective at this point, I’ve been going every morning just in case. At least if he sees a car there he will be deterred to keep driving by because the police were a complete letdown,” he told the Daily Mail. “I promised my wife and kids I wouldn’t hurt him but I’m afraid to confront him because I wouldn’t be able to control myself if I got that close to him. He did this to my mother’s grave for months maybe years. Every cop I speak to has said ‘you’re a better man than me cause I would have killed him.'”
